Discover Vicenza: A Vicenza Tour Guide Experience
Begin your Private Palladio Venice Day Tours from Venice with a captivating walking tour of Vicenza, guided by an expert Palladian tour guide. Vicenza, dramatically reshaped in the 16th century by architect Andrea Palladio, boasts a stunning array of civic buildings, a basilica, and aristocratic residences. With one of the highest ratios of historical buildings to population in Italy and rec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age site, the city serves as a living museum to Palladio's vast contributions, with his works prominently featured throughout the medieval center.

Palladio's Masterpieces: Olympic Theater in Vicenza Tour
As we meander through Vicenza’s streets and back-alleys, we delve into the life and times of Palladio, exploring the influences that shaped his revolutionary architectural style. A tour highlight is a visit to the Olympic Theater, one of the purest creations of Renaissance architecture in Italy and considered Palladio’s most beautiful work. This experience in Vicenza is enriched by insights into Palladio's famed Basilica and the architectural marvels that dot the city.

Exploring Palladian Villas: Villa Godi
Our excursion then takes us along picturesque back-roads through the beautiful countryside to Villa Godi, the first villa accredited to Andrea Palladio. This villa presented significant challenges to the then-inexperienced architect. Our Palladian expert local guide will lead a tour of the villa and its historically significant gardens, designed by the Gardeners of Prince Edward during World War I when the villa served as the headquarters of British forces in northeastern Italy.

Discover its Splendor in the Villa Rotonda Tour
The pinnacle of our Private Palladio Venice Day Tours is a visit to the Villa Rotonda, celebrated for its temple-like facades, perfect symmetry, and idyllic natural setting hallmarks of Palladian architecture. Open seasonally, the villa is Palladio's most famed work, originally built as an entertainment venue rather than a residence. Here, you will experience the architectural splendor that exemplifies the principles of Palladian design.

Private Vicenza Tour from Venice Important Information and Accessibility
Villa Rotonda interior is open only on Fri, Sat & Sun from mid-March up to first week of December. On other days it is possible to organize a private visit on request (the cost is about 300 Euro). Olympic Theater is open daily, except Mondays.
